A Stonemason is responsible for cutting, shaping, and installing natural or artificial stone to construct or repair building structures such as walls, facades, floors, and ornamental features. The role requires precision craftsmanship, technical knowledge, and adherence to safety and quality standards in construction projects. Key Responsibilities Read and interpret architectural drawings, blueprints, and specifications. Cut, shape, and dress stones using chisels, hammers, grinders, or saws. Lay and align stones with mortar or other bonding materials to construct walls, arches, columns, and facades. Repair or restore damaged stonework in existing buildings or monuments. Prepare and mix mortar or cement for fixing and pointing stone joints. Install stone veneers, claddings, tiles, or decorative stonework. Polish, grind, or finish stone surfaces for a smooth and aesthetic appearance. Erect scaffolding and ensure safe work practices at height. Collaborate with site supervisors, architects, and other trades to meet design and quality requirements. Maintain tools and equipment in good working condition. Follow all safety and environmental regulations at the worksite. Requirements Minimum Education: Primary or Secondary education. Preferred Certification (Singapore): BCA CoreTrade – Stone Masonry Work / Tiling & Stone Finishing or Certificate of Trade Test (CTT). Apply Workplace Safety and Health (WSH) in Construction Sites (CSOC). Experience: Minimum 2–3 years of relevant work experience in masonry, tiling, or stone finishing. Knowledge: Understanding of different types of natural and artificial stones, bonding techniques, and finishing methods. Skills Skilled in stone cutting, shaping, and fitting with precision. Proficient in reading and interpreting technical drawings and layouts. Knowledge of mortar mixing, cement ratios, and adhesion methods. Ability to use hand and power tools such as grinders, saws, and polishers. Understanding of structural alignment, leveling, and measurement. Experience in restoration and decorative stonework preferred. Attention to detail, symmetry, and aesthetic finishing. Good hand-eye coordination and manual dexterity. Strong safety awareness and compliance with construction regulations. Teamwork and communication skills for coordination with other trades. Physical strength and endurance for handling heavy materials. Problem-solving ability for irregular shapes or design challenges. Time management and reliability in meeting project deadlines.
